Mackinaw Bridge summer splendor canvas print by Joe Holley. Bring your artwork to life with the texture and depth of a stretched canvas print. Your image gets printed onto one of our premium canvases and then stretched on a wooden frame of 1.5" x 1.5" stretcher bars (gallery wrap) or 5/8" x 5/8" stretcher bars (museum wrap). Your canvas print will be delivered to you "ready to hang" with pre-attached hanging wire, mounting hooks, and nails.

About Joe Holley
Hi, I've been in photography most of my life since I was fourteen when I shot film. I switched to digital back in 2009 and am amazed at the changes since then. In June 2020 I was chosen by the DNR of Michigan to be an ambassador for the State Parks of Michigan showcasing them through my images. I have also been the Vice President and President of the Mid Michigan Photo Club in Lansing, MI.
